What is a Micron?
A micron (μm) is a unit of length in the metric system, equal to one-millionth of a meter. It's commonly used to measure the size of small objects, such as cells, microorganisms, and dust particles.
What is a Millimeter?
A millimeter (mm) is a unit of length in the metric system, equal to one-thousandth of a meter. It's commonly used to measure the size of larger objects, such as paper, objects, and distances.
Converting 60 Micron to Millimeter
To convert 60 microns to millimeters, we need to divide 60 by 1,000, since there are 1,000 microns in a millimeter.
60 μm = 60 / 1,000 = 0.06 mm
So, 60 microns are equivalent to 0.06 millimeters.
